Эта документация перемещена в архив и не поддерживается.

Control.FontStyle - свойство

Обновлен: Ноябрь 2007

Возвращает или задает стиль шрифта. Это свойство зависимостей.

Пространство имен:  System.Windows.Controls
Сборка:  PresentationFramework (в PresentationFramework.dll)
XMLNS для XAML: http://schemas.microsoft.com/winfx/xaml/presentation

[BindableAttribute(true)]
public FontStyle FontStyle { get; set; }
/** @property */
/** @attribute BindableAttribute(true) */
public FontStyle get_FontStyle()
/** @property */
/** @attribute BindableAttribute(true) */
public  void set_FontStyle(FontStyle value)

public function get FontStyle () : FontStyle
public function set FontStyle (value : FontStyle)

Значение свойства

Тип: System.Windows.FontStyle
Значение FontStyle. Значением по умолчанию является свойство FontStyles.Normal.

Поле идентификатора

FontStyleProperty

Свойствам метаданных присвоено значение true

AffectsMeasure, AffectsRender, Inherits

Данное свойство влияет только на тот элемент управления, чей шаблон использует свойство FontStyle как параметр. На другие элементы управления это свойство не влияет.

В следующем примере показано, как установить свойство стиля шрифта для элемента управления.

<Button Name="btn4" FontStyle="Normal" 
        Click="ChangeFontStyle">
  FontStyle
</Button>


void ChangeFontStyle(object sender, RoutedEventArgs e)
{
    if (btn4.FontStyle == FontStyles.Italic)
    {
        btn4.FontStyle = FontStyles.Normal;
        btn4.Content = "FontStyle";
    }
    else
    {
        btn4.FontStyle = FontStyles.Italic;
        btn4.Content = "Control font style changes from Normal to Italic.";
    }
}


Windows Vista

Среды .NET Framework и .NET Compact Framework поддерживают не все версии каждой платформы. Поддерживаемые версии перечислены в разделе Требования к системе для .NET Framework.

.NET Framework

Поддерживается в версиях: 3.5, 3.0
Показ: